  • 1. Please give an overview of your role and what this involves on a day-to-day basis:
  • Fault finding of circuit boards down to a component level

    8/10

  • 2. Have you learnt any new skills or developed existing skills?
  • I've developed my networking and observation skills that have allowed me to learn the different procedures here

    8/10

  • 3. To what extent do you enjoy your programme?
  • I enjoy it a lot especially with how incorporated we are with the company

    8/10

  • 4. How well organised/structured is your programme?
  • Considering how new this program is I find it well organised and can only improve

    7/10

  • 5. How much support do you receive from your employer?
  • We are given a lot of support with them allowing us time to work on our college work as well as any help needed with stuff outside of work

    7/10

  • 6. How much support do you receive from your training provider when working towards your qualifications?
  • They are able to help with any of their work if we email them and they are also able to help with any issues outside of college

    6/10

  • 7. How well do you feel that your qualification (through your training provider) helps you to perform better in your role?
  • There are some parts that benefit me to get better at my role, however, some parts are confusing as to how they are meant to help me

    5/10

  • 8. Are there extra-curricular activities to get involved in at your work? (For example, any social activities, sports teams, or even professional networking events.)
  • There are many networks here to get involved with that cover a wide range of activities

    9/10

  • 9a. Would you recommend GE Aerospace to a friend?
  • Yes


  • 9b. Why?
  • The community here is great and the company is moving in a very positive direction


  • 10. What tips or advice would you give to others applying to GE Aerospace?
  • Be confident in yourself and your ability to get tasks done
